bfdaf32fInit
DT32S bfdaf32fInit(asptBfdaf32f *bfdaf,DT32S M,DT32S L,DT32F mu,DT32S cs,DT32S *ip,DT32F *w)
Initializes an asptBfdaf32f filter and allocates its necessary storage buffers - Returns :
-
Error code. On failure, the filterLength member of the filter is set to zero.
- Input Parameters :
- bfdaf : pointer to the asptbfdaf32f to be initialized
- M : number of time domain filter coefficients
- L : block length (number of new samples each block)
- mu : step size.
- cs : constrained (1) or unconstrained (0) filter.
- ip : fft bit reversal table
- w : fft twiddle factor table.
- Output Parameters :
- bfdaf is initialized using the given input arguments.
- Error Conditions
- ASPT_NO_ERR : Initialization is successful
- ASPT_NULL_PTR_ERR : ip/w is a NULL pointer
- ASPT_RANGE_ERR : L/M is not a valid input value
- ASPT_NO_MEM_ERR : could not allocate memory

bfdaf32fInitStatic
DT32S bfdaf32fInitStatic(asptBfdaf32f *bfdaf,DT32S M,DT32S L,DT32F mu,DT32S cs,DT32F *pCof,DT32F *pDat,DT32S *ip,DT32F *w)
Initializes an asptBfdaf32f filter to use pre-allocated memory blocks - Returns :
-
Error code. On failure, the filterLength member of the filter is set to zero.
- Input Parameters :
- bfdaf : pointer to the asptbfdaf32f to be initialized
- M : number of time domain filter coefficients
- L : block length (number of new samples each block)
- mu : step size.
- cs : constrained (1) or unconstrained (0) filter.
- pCof : pointer to a pre-allocated memory in program memory
of at least [fftLength] DT32F locations to be used for the filter coefficients.
- pDat : pointer to a pre-allocated memory in data memory of at least
[C1 + 2*fftLength + 2*(fftLength/2+1)] DT32F locations to be used for data storage.
- ip : FFT bit reversal table
- w : FFT twiddle factor table.
- Output Parameters :
- bfdaf is initialized using the given input arguments.
- Error Conditions
- ASPT_NO_ERR : Initialization is successful
- ASPT_NULL_PTR_ERR : ip/w is a NULL pointer
- ASPT_RANGE_ERR : L/M is not a valid input value
- ASPT_NO_MEM_ERR : could not allocate memory
- Remarks :
-
fftLength = 2^(nextpow2(L+M-1)). C1 = fftLength - blockLength.

bfdaf32fFilterUpdate
DT32S bfdaf32fFilterUpdate(asptBfdaf32f *bfdaf, DT32F *inp, DT32F *des, DT32F *out, DT32F *err)
Calculates the filter output and updates the filter coefficients for the asptBfdaf32f filter.- Returns :
- Input Parameters :
- bfdaf : asptBfdaf32f filter to be processed
- inp : pointer to the new block of input samples
- des : pointer to the new block of desired signal samples
- Output Parameters :
- out : pointer to an array to store the filter output samples
- err : pointer to store the error (des - out) samples.
- Error Conditions
- ASPT_NO_ERR : success
- ASPT_NULL_PTR_ERR : NULL pointer error

bfdaf32fFilterOnly
DT32S bfdaf32fFilterOnly(asptBfdaf32f *bfdaf, DT32F *inp, DT32F *out)
Calculates the filter output but does not update the filter coefficients for the asptBfdaf32f filter. It also updates the internal buffers and power estimate.- Returns :
- Input Parameters :
- bfdaf : asptBfdaf32f filter to be processed
- inp : pointer to the new block of input samples
- Output Parameters :
- out : pointer to an array to store the filter output samples
- Error Conditions
- ASPT_NO_ERR : success
- ASPT_NULL_PTR_ERR : NULL pointer error

bfdaf32fFree
void bfdaf32fFree(asptBfdaf32f *bfdaf)
Frees the allocated memory for this asptBfdaf32f filter. - Returns :
- Input Parameters :
- bfdaf : pointer to asptBfdaf32f filter
- Remarks :
-
Use this function only with filters created with bfdaf32fInit(). Do not use with asptBfdaf32f filters created using bfdaf32fInitStatic().

bfdaf32fGetCoef
DT32S bfdaf32fGetCoef(asptBfdaf32f *bfdaf, DT32F *dstBuf, DT32S ind, DT32S N, DT32S flip)
Copies N internal filter coefficients starting from coef[ind] to dstBuf. - Returns :
-
On success returns the number of coefficients copied, otherwise the error code (negative int).
- Input Parameters :
- bfdaf : pointer to asptBfdaf32f filter.
- dstBuf : destination buffer.
- ind : index to the first coefficient to be copied.
- N : number of coefficients to be copied.
- flip : if not 0, will flip the coefficients order.
- Error Conditions
- ASPT_NULL_PTR_ERR : dstBuf/bfdaf->wFreq is a NULL pointer
- ASPT_RANGE_ERR : ind/N is not a valid input value

bfdaf32fSetCoef
DT32S bfdaf32fSetCoef(asptBfdaf32f *bfdaf, DT32F *newCoef, DT32S ind, DT32S N, DT32S flip)
Initializes N internal (time domain) filter coefficients starting from coef[ind] to the contents of newCoef. - Returns :
-
On success returns the number of coefficients copied, otherwise the error code (negative int).
- Input Parameters :
- bfdaf : pointer to the asptBfdaf32f filter to be set.
- newCoef : new coefficients vector.
- ind : index to the first coefficient to be set.
- N : number of coefficients to be set.
- flip : if not 0, will copy the coefficients in reverse order.
- Error Conditions
- ASPT_NULL_PTR_ERR : newCoef/bfdaf->wFreq is a NULL pointer
- ASPT_RANGE_ERR : ind/N is not a valid input value

bfdaf32fResize
DT32S bfdaf32fResize(asptBfdaf32f *bfdaf, DT32S newLen, DT32S newBlock)
Resizes an asptBfdaf32f filter keeping as much of the filter state as possible. - Returns :
- Input Parameters :
- bfdaf : pointer to the asptBfdaf32f filter to be resized.
- newLen : required new filter length
- newBlock : new block length
- Error Conditions
- ASPT_NO_ERR : Resizing is successful
- ASPT_NULL_PTR_ERR : NULL pointer error
- ASPT_RANGE_ERR : newLength/newBlock is not a valid input value
- ASPT_NO_MEM_ERR : Could not allocate the necessary filter storage
- Remarks :
-
Use this function only with dynamically allocated asptBfdaf32f filters.
